Client:
Maine Health Care Purchasing Collaborative

Challenge:
Conduct a state health care market analysis and determine how competition might be injected into the market by an employer/broker coalition.

Response:
Bailit performed a feasibility assessment for the development of a multi-employer purchasing initiative in Maine. Activities include interviews, employer focus groups, assessment of the experience of other efforts elsewhere in the country, development of purchasing models, and model testing.


Client:
Center for Health Care Strategies, Inc.

Challenge:
Identify causes for HMO market departures from the Medicaid programs in the Mid-Atlantic states.

Response:
Bailit performed a health care market assessment of the Mid-Atlantic states as well as of the specific trend of HMOs leaving the Medicaid market, and advised the states in a group consultation on strategies to respond to general market changes.


Client:
State of Kansas Insurance Department

Challenge:
Understand why certain small employers in Kansas do not offer health insurance to their employees.

Response:
Bailit conducted a literature review, focus groups, interviews, and public meetings across the state with Insurance Department staff, and reported findings to a state advisory committee. Research considered small businesses that did, and did not, offer health insurance.


Client:
The Center for Health Policy Development (CHPD)/National Academy for State Health Policy (NASHP)

Challenge:
Identify the implications of state Medicaid budget cuts for state Medicaid managed care programs.

Response:
Using survey data and interviews with state Medicaid and oversight agency staff in four states, Bailit staff synthesized information gathered about the strategies that states have employed to reduce the Medicaid budget, and the policy, programmatic and operational implications these strategies have had for the states? Medicaid managed care plans. The paper highlights key findings and lessons learned that would benefit both states and managed care plans.
